GAZA, April 11 (KUNA) -- The Palestinian Islamic Jihad movement warned
Israel on Monday that it would retaliate for any offensive that might be waged
on Gaza Strip.
The group has not pleaded for a cease-fire "from any party and will not
request that from any body," the group spokesman in Gaza Daoud Shehab said in
a statement. "If the war is dictated on us, we will fight and we have nothing
to fear or cry for," he added.
"The truce in our eyes means nothing, we do not trust the occupation or
their pledges. What we are concerned about is the field condition. If there is
calm, it will be appreciated but if an aggression is waged against our people,
nothing will deter us from retaliating," he warned.
